We are seeking experienced full-stack engineers to join teams across Figma’s Growth and Monetization Engineering organization. This group encompasses several teams—including Growth, Billing, Enterprise, and Discovery—each tackling complex challenges that enable millions of users, from startups to Fortune 500 companies, to maximize their use of Figma. Depending on your team, responsibilities may include designing global-scale billing infrastructure, building secure enterprise access systems, enhancing user discovery and organization of work, or driving product-led growth and monetization initiatives.
As a Software Engineer, Growth & Monetization, you will design and scale reliable, secure, and intuitive systems that power collaboration across Figma’s product suite. You will play a key role in driving our rapid growth, global expansion, and evolving product surface area, working closely with cross-functional partners to ensure our technology meets the needs of our most sophisticated customers.
This is a full-time role that can be held from one of our US hubs or remotely in the United States.
What you’ll do at Figma:
- Design, build, test, and ship high-quality features across the stack, utilizing technologies like TypeScript, React, Ruby, Go, C++, and more.
- Own key parts of the product that significantly impact user experience, internal productivity, or revenue operations.
- Collaborate with cross-functional partners in product, design, data science, support, and sales to shape product direction and solve complex problems.
- Operate and monitor the systems you build, maintaining a strong focus on reliability, security, performance, and user experience.
- Contribute to team culture by mentoring peers, providing feedback, and helping foster a collaborative and inclusive engineering environment.
We’d Love to Hear From You If You Have:
- 4+ years of professional software engineering experience, with a proven track record of shipping and maintaining complex systems or products in production.
- Full-stack experience with modern front-end frameworks (e.g., React/TypeScript) and back-end technologies (e.g., Ruby, Python, Go, PostgreSQL).
- Strong collaboration and communication skills, with experience working effectively across functions.
Added Pluses:
- Experience with B2B SaaS, billing/payments infrastructure, developer platforms, or enterprise-scale systems.
- Familiarity with technologies such as Stripe, Salesforce, NetSuite, Snowflake, SCIM, SAML, or WebAssembly.
- A background in experimentation, observability, compliance automation, or internal tools development.
- Prior work on extensibility platforms (plugins, APIs, widgets), or experience contributing to open-source developer communities.
- Passion for crafting excellent developer or user experiences, and an eye for elegant, maintainable architecture.
- Enthusiasm for learning and teaching—whether mentoring teammates, leading initiatives, or sharing knowledge in code reviews or pairing sessions.
